    Hi @annoy, apologies for the delay here, I’m back now.

    We just released The Events Calendar 6.0.4. We fixed quite a few errors in this release, and it may have solved this issue with Yoast SEO as well. Please update and let us know if that fixes the issue here.

    To be safe, we’d recommend conducting tests and updates on a Staging Server and keep a working backup of your website.

    Also, please clear any caching for both third-party plugins and server-side (if you have any). It would also be good to flush permalinks.
